@@ -366,9 +366,7 @@ impl<C: Blockchain> TriggersAdapterWrapper<C> {
366366 if let Some ( entity_type) = ent. first ( ) {
367367 let et = schema. entity_type ( entity_type) . unwrap ( ) ;
368368
369- let f: u32 = from as u32 ;
370- let t: u32 = to as u32 ;
371- let br: Range < u32 > = f..t;
369+ let br: Range < BlockNumber > = from..to;
372370 let entities = store. get_range ( & et, br) ?;
373371 return self
374372 . subgraph_triggers (
@@ -416,7 +414,7 @@ impl<C: Blockchain> TriggersAdapterWrapper<C> {
416414 from : BlockNumber ,
417415 to : BlockNumber ,
418416 filter : & Arc < TriggerFilterWrapper < C > > ,
419- entities : BTreeMap < BlockNumber , Entity > ,
417+ entities : BTreeMap < BlockNumber , Vec < Entity > > ,
420418 ) -> Result < ( Vec < BlockWithTriggers < C > > , BlockNumber ) , Error > {
421419 let logger2 = logger. cheap_clone ( ) ;
422420 let adapter = self . adapter . clone ( ) ;
@@ -430,7 +428,7 @@ impl<C: Blockchain> TriggersAdapterWrapper<C> {
430428 match entities. get ( & key) {
431429 Some ( e) => {
432430 let trigger_data =
433- vec ! [ Self :: create_subgraph_trigger_from_entity( first_filter, e) ] ;
431+ Self :: create_subgraph_trigger_from_entity ( first_filter, e) ;
434432 Some ( BlockWithTriggers :: new_with_subgraph_triggers (
435433 block,
436434 trigger_data,
0 commit comments